Time to celebrate?
It’s official – we’re out of recession! Some positive news for a change and time to celebrate.
But hang on just a minute. Many economic commentators don’t see 2010 as being a year of strong growth. And there is cause for further caution - there are figures out there that show that more businesses go out of business coming out of a recession than when in the thick of it.
So if you really care about survival, then the rest of 2010 is going to be about being seen. By the right people. In the right places. Doing the right things.
So what are you going to do about it? First things first - your staff. Happy staff means a happy company so there will have to be plenty of reassurance and briefings. Keeping your people informed so they are all on message and understand what is going on in the business and market as a whole.
Next your existing customers. Make sure you service them like there is no tomorrow. Make them feel valued. Build relationships and loyalty. Above all offer them a fantastic service so they have no reason to go elsewhere. And keep communicating with them. If you don’t then you can be sure that your competitors will.
Next you need to be seen by your prospects. You need to make more noise than your competitors as there are companies out there that do need your services – finding them is the trick.
Never before has your brand been so important. Why? Because the common link between all your stakeholders is your brand.
We believe that a strong brand equals a strong company. It is the umbrella behind which all your staff can unite. If used correctly it gives your customers belief and trust. And when implemented consistently it generates awareness, trust and a clear understanding of what you stand for. All this makes it easier for companies to believe, trust and buy from you. And never before has this been so important.
